PlayStation Plus April 2026 – Full Game List
The PlayStation Plus Game Catalog April 2026 lineup launches on April 21 for Extra and Premium members, bringing a mix of AAA hits, indie gems, and some seriously weird fun.
Hidden Gems in This Month’s Lineup
Not everything here is AAA – and that’s a good thing. Some of the most interesting picks include:
- Squirrel with a Gun – pure chaos and meme energy
- Monster Train – one of the best roguelike deckbuilders ever made
- The Casting of Frank Stone – narrative horror from the Dead by Daylight universe
Pro Tip: If you only try one indie this month, go for Monster Train – it’s insanely addictive once it clicks.
PlayStation Plus Premium Bonus
Premium subscribers also get access to a classic:
Wild Arms 4 (PS2) – enhanced with modern features like rewind and quick save
It’s a solid pick for JRPG fans who want something nostalgic with modern convenience.
